The Question: To raise awareness of the many contributions of African Americans to history, scholar Carter Godwin Woodson launched Negro History Week during the second week of February in 1926. (This event became an annual celebration and was expanded to the entire month of February in 1950.)  What is the significance of the second week of February?

The Answer: The second week of February marks the birthdays of Frederick Douglass and Abraham Lincoln.
